The name of the author may not be used to endorse or promote products *    derived from this software without specific prior written permission. * * THIS SOFTWARE IS PROVIDED BY THE AUTHOR ``AS IS'' AND ANY EXPRESS OR * IMPLIED WARRANTIES, INCLUDING, BUT NOT LIMITED TO, THE IMPLIED WARRANTIES * OF MERCHANTABILITY AND FITNESS FOR A PARTICULAR PURPOSE ARE DISCLAIMED. * IN NO EVENT SHALL THE AUTHOR BE LIABLE FOR ANY DIRECT, INDIRECT, * INCIDENTAL, SPECIAL, EXEMPLARY, OR CONSEQUENTIAL DAMAGES (INCLUDING, BUT * NOT LIMITED TO, PROCUREMENT OF SUBSTITUTE GOODS OR SERVICES; LOSS OF USE, * DATA, OR PROFITS; OR BUSINESS INTERRUPTION) HOWEVER CAUSED AND ON ANY * THEORY OF LIABILITY, WHETHER IN CONTRACT, STRICT LIABILITY, OR TORT * (INCLUDING NEGLIGENCE OR OTHERWISE) ARISING IN ANY WAY OUT OF THE USE OF * THIS SOFTWARE, EVEN IF ADVISED OF THE POSSIBILITY OF SUCH DAMAGE. */#ifdef DDB#define	integrate#define hide#else#define	integrate	static __inline#define hide		static#endif/* * Ethernet software status per device. * * Each interface is referenced by a network interface structure, * arpcom.ac_if, which the routing code uses to locate the interface.  * This structure contains the output queue for the interface, its address, ... * * NOTE: this structure MUST be the first element in machine-dependent * le_softc structures!  This is designed SPECIFICALLY to make it possible * to simply cast a "void *" to "struct le_softc *" or to * "struct am7990_softc *".  Among other things, this saves a lot of hair * in the interrupt handlers. */struct am7990_softc {	struct	device sc_dev;		/* base device glue */	struct	arpcom sc_arpcom;	/* Ethernet common part */	/*	 * Memory functions:	 *	 *	copy to/from descriptor	 *	copy to/from buffer	 *	zero bytes in buffer	 */	void	(*sc_copytodesc)		    __P((struct am7990_softc *, void *, int, int));	void	(*sc_copyfromdesc)		    __P((struct am7990_softc *, void *, int, int));	void	(*sc_copytobuf)		    __P((struct am7990_softc *, void *, int, int));	void	(*sc_copyfrombuf)		    __P((struct am7990_softc *, void *, int, int));	void	(*sc_zerobuf)		    __P((struct am7990_softc *, int, int));	/*	 * Machine-dependent functions:	 *	 *	read/write CSR	 *	hardware reset hook - may be NULL	 *	hardware init hook - may be NULL	 *	no carrier hook - may be NULL	 */	u_int16_t (*sc_rdcsr)		    __P((struct am7990_softc *, u_int16_t));	void	(*sc_wrcsr)		    __P((struct am7990_softc *, u_int16_t, u_int16_t));	void	(*sc_hwreset) __P((struct am7990_softc *));	void	(*sc_hwinit) __P((struct am7990_softc *));	void	(*sc_nocarrier) __P((struct am7990_softc *));	int	sc_hasifmedia;	struct	ifmedia sc_ifmedia;#ifndef PROM	void	*sc_sh;		/* shutdownhook cookie */#endif	u_int16_t sc_conf3;	/* CSR3 value */	void	*sc_mem;	/* base address of RAM -- CPU's view */	u_long	sc_addr;	/* base address of RAM -- LANCE's view */	u_long	sc_memsize;	/* size of RAM */	int	sc_nrbuf;	/* number of receive buffers */	int	sc_ntbuf;	/* number of transmit buffers */	int	sc_last_rd;	int	sc_first_td, sc_last_td, sc_no_td;	int	sc_initaddr;	int	sc_rmdaddr;	int	sc_tmdaddr;	int	sc_rbufaddr;	int	sc_tbufaddr;#ifdef LEDEBUG	int	sc_debug;#endif};/* Export this to machine-dependent drivers. */extern struct cfdriver le_cd;#ifdef PROMtypedef int ifnet_ret_t;#elsetypedef void ifnet_ret_t;#endifvoid am7990_config __P((struct am7990_softc *));void am7990_init __P((struct am7990_softc *));int am7990_ioctl __P((struct ifnet *, u_long, caddr_t));void am7990_meminit __P((struct am7990_softc *));void am7990_reset __P((struct am7990_softc *));void am7990_setladrf __P((struct arpcom *, u_int16_t *));ifnet_ret_t am7990_start __P((struct ifnet *));void am7990_stop __P((struct am7990_softc *));#ifdef PROMifnet_ret_t am7990_watchdog __P((int unit));#elseifnet_ret_t am7990_watchdog __P((struct ifnet *));#endifint am7990_intr __P((void *));/* * The following functions are only useful on certain cpu/bus * combinations.  They should be written in assembly language for * maximum efficiency, but machine-independent versions are provided * for drivers that have not yet been optimized. */void am7990_copytobuf_contig __P((struct am7990_softc *, void *, int, int));void am7990_copyfrombuf_contig __P((struct am7990_softc *, void *, int, int));void am7990_zerobuf_contig __P((struct am7990_softc *, int, int));#if 0	/* Example only - see am7990.c */void am7990_copytobuf_gap2 __P((struct am7990_softc *, void *, int, int));void am7990_copyfrombuf_gap2 __P((struct am7990_softc *, void *, int, int));void am7990_zerobuf_gap2 __P((struct am7990_softc *, int, int));void am7990_copytobuf_gap16 __P((struct am7990_softc *, void *, int, int));void am7990_copyfrombuf_gap16 __P((struct am7990_softc *, void *, int, int));void am7990_zerobuf_gap16 __P((struct am7990_softc *, int, int));#endif /* Example only */
